In modern engineering, especially in the fields of mechanical and chemical engineering, the term jacket drain valve plays a crucial role in ensuring the efficiency and safety of various systems. A jacket drain valve is a specialized valve used to manage the flow of fluids within a jacketed system, which is designed to provide temperature control for sensitive processes. Understanding the function and importance of the jacket drain valve can greatly enhance our appreciation of how complex machinery operates.A jacketed system typically consists of two layers: an inner layer that carries the process fluid and an outer layer filled with a heating or cooling medium. The purpose of this configuration is to maintain the desired temperature of the process fluid, which is particularly important in chemical reactions where temperature fluctuations can lead to undesirable results. The jacket drain valve is strategically placed at the lowest point of the jacket to allow for the drainage of any excess fluid that may accumulate during operation.The operation of the jacket drain valve is straightforward yet vital. When the jacket needs to be drained, the valve is opened, allowing the fluid to flow out. This process not only prevents the buildup of pressure within the jacket but also ensures that the system can operate efficiently without interruptions. If the jacket drain valve were to malfunction, it could lead to serious issues such as overheating, which could compromise the integrity of the entire system.Moreover, regular maintenance of the jacket drain valve is essential for the longevity of the equipment. Engineers must routinely check these valves for any signs of wear and tear, ensuring that they are functioning correctly. Neglecting the maintenance of a jacket drain valve can result in costly repairs and downtime, affecting production schedules and overall productivity.Another aspect to consider is the materials used in the construction of a jacket drain valve. Depending on the application, these valves can be made from various materials, including stainless steel, brass, or plastic. The choice of material is often dictated by the type of fluid being handled and the operating conditions, such as temperature and pressure. Selecting the appropriate material is crucial, as it directly impacts the valve's performance and lifespan.In addition to its practical applications, the jacket drain valve also serves as a reminder of the intricate design and engineering principles involved in industrial systems.
